Ayo Edebiri to Write and Star in A24's Live-Action Barney Movie
2025-02-25

The highly anticipated live-action adaptation of the beloved children’s icon Barney is gaining momentum. Produced by Mattel Films and Daniel Kaluuya’s 59% Productions, the film has secured Emmy and Golden Globe winner Ayo Edebiri to pen the screenplay and potentially star in the lead role. Since its initial announcement in 2019, this project has been shrouded in secrecy, with only hints about its direction. Kevin McKeon and Andrew Scannell from Mattel Films are overseeing the production, while Robbie Brenner and the team at 59% Productions are handling the creative aspects. This new take on Barney aims to appeal to an adult audience, focusing on the surreal and nostalgic elements that resonate with millennials who grew up watching the purple dinosaur.

Barney, a character that has charmed generations of children since his debut in 1988, became a global sensation through the PBS series "Barney & Friends," which ran for 14 seasons. In a recent interview, Mattel executive Kevin McKeon revealed that the live-action version would adopt a more mature and surrealistic tone, drawing inspiration from films by Charlie Kaufman and Spike Jonze. The movie will explore themes of millennial angst and the challenges faced by adults who grew up with Barney, offering a fresh perspective on the character. Despite the unconventional approach, Mattel CEO Ynon Kreiz assured that the film would remain entertaining and culturally relevant without veering into odd territory.

Edebiri, a rising star known for her roles in "The Bear" and her directorial work on the same series, brings both acting and writing expertise to the project. Her involvement adds a layer of excitement as she transitions from television to the big screen. With her DGA Award nomination for directing and her contributions to acclaimed series like "What We Do in the Shadows" and "Dickinson," Edebiri is poised to bring a unique voice to the Barney adaptation. Additionally, she recently voiced Envy in Pixar’s "Inside Out 2" and will appear in several upcoming films, including A24’s thriller "Opus" and Luca Guadagnino’s "After the Hunt."

Mattel, riding high on the success of "Barbie," is expanding its cinematic universe with projects like "Matchbox" and "Masters of the Universe." The company is also developing various other features based on its iconic properties, ensuring a steady stream of content that appeals to both nostalgia and contemporary audiences.
